The suitable candidate will be able to perform the following duties:
Under the direction of Director of the Woodland Wellness Centre, ensure the development and implementation of HR initiatives and systems
Maintain employee information on HR information System
Develop monthly staffing reports
Provide counseling on policies and procedures
Be actively involved in recruitment by preparing job descriptions, posting ads and managing the hiring process
Create and implement effective onboarding plans
Develop training and development programs in consultation with Director of the Woodland Wellness Centre
Assist Director of the Woodland Wellness Centre in performance management processes
Support the management of disciplinary and grievance issues
Maintain employee records (attendance, EEO data etc.) according to policy and legal requirements
Review employment and working conditions to ensure legal compliance
The suitable candidate will possess the following qualifications:
Bachelors Degree in Human Resource Management with 3 years of core Human Resources experience, or a Diploma in Human Resource with 5 years experience in core Human Resources
A CHRP designation is an asset
Excellent computer skills
Must be very professional and serve as a leading role model to all Department employees with the utmost professionalism, discretion and confidentiality
Dynamic, outgoing individual who is a strong team player with an ability to perform independently
Excellent interpersonal and communication skills with an ability to resolve conflicts objectively and with understanding
Must have a valid drivers license and own a vehicle
Must provide a satisfactory and recent; Drivers Abstract, Criminal Record Check/Vulnerable Sector Check
